I have an SL-6. Presently in storage, but I love it and plan to take it out and use it as my primary turntable.
I had a similar problem-the landing point.
In the back of the SL-6, there is a screw near the top, a couple of inches from the hinge of the dust cover. It looks like it would be a chassis adjustment screw of some sort, but it is not.
That screw adjusts the landing point of the arm at the beginning of the record. I suggest you adjust that-I'll bet that is your problem.
